The part people don't want to hear is that sidewall and shoulder damage can't be repaired safely, however small it looks. A bulge means the cords inside have already failed and the tyre could let go without warning, and a deep cut or a cracked, perished sidewall carries the same risk. When that's what we find, we say so plainly and fit a replacement from the van in the correct size, right where the car sits. If it turns out to be shallow scuffing that hasn't reached the structure, we'll tell you it's fine and won't push a tyre you don't need.
